[죽은 시인의 사회] Iconic Film Adapted into First Official Korean Stage Play Featuring Star-Studded Cast
The beloved film 'Dead Poets Society' is set to debut on the Korean stage as an officially licensed theatrical production. Directed by Jo Gwang-hwa, the play features high-profile actors Cha In-pyo, Oh Man-seok, and Yeon Jung-hoon sharing the role of John Keating. At a press conference held on June 22 at the Artists' House in Seoul, the cast discussed the deep questions of life and choice that the play explores. The production, which marks a significant theatrical debut for Cha In-pyo after 34 years in the industry, will run from July 18 to September 13 at the NOL Theater in Daehak-ro.
- Cha In-pyo, Oh Man-seok, and Yeon Jung-hoon will alternate as the lead, marking a historic first official licensed adaptation of the story for the Korean stage.
- The performance schedule is confirmed to run from July 18 to September 13 at the NOL Theater in Seoul, featuring a diverse cast including SF9's Chani.
